Leave Coimbatore around 5:00 AM by car or tempo traveller and take NH544 through Walayar and Palakkad, then continue toward Thrissur and the coast. The drive usually takes about 3–3½ hours, but allow extra time for a breakfast stop and August traffic. Shared fuel and tolls should work out to roughly ₹400–₹700 per person. Pack towels, a change of clothes, drinking water, sunscreen, and waterproof covers for phones; beachside parking and facilities can be basic.
Reach Snehatheeram Beach in Thalikulam around 8:30 AM. Spend the morning swimming only where locals or lifeguards indicate it is safe, then split into teams for football, frisbee, or other beach games and leave time for group photos. The beach is best enjoyed before the midday heat; avoid going too far into the water, especially if the sea is rough during the monsoon. Freshen up and grab simple beach snacks before leaving around 10:30 AM.
Around noon, choose a busy local seafood restaurant near Snehatheeram Beach rather than an empty tourist-looking place. Kerala meals with fish curry, fried fish, prawns, or squid generally cost ₹250–₹450 per person; ask about the catch and prices before ordering. After lunch, drive roughly 15–25 minutes to Vadanappally Beach for a quieter second coastal stop from 1:30 to 3:00 PM. Keep this one relaxed—walk along the shore, play a short game, and take photos, but don’t plan another long swim if the sea is choppy.
Head toward central Thrissur and stop around Swaraj Round from 4:30 to 6:00 PM for tea, fresh juice, and Kerala snacks such as pazhampori, parippu vada, or unniyappam at a busy local café or bakery. Budget ₹100–₹200 per person, and use this break to change into dry clothes and refuel before the long drive. Leave by about 6:00 PM via NH544 through Palakkad and Walayar; allow 3½–4 hours, with a dinner or fuel stop near Palakkad, reaching Coimbatore around 10:00 PM. Keep the driver rested, rotate seats, and avoid stretching the evening too late after a full beach day.
